THCa badder is really a cannabis focus having a tender, creamy consistency. It’s created by extracting THCa-rich material from cannabis plants working with solvents like butane or CO2, then purging the solvents to create a concentrated, high-THCa product. THCa badder can be dabbed, vaporized, or utilized like a topping for bowls or joints.
